.Header_Header__xIKfd{position:fixed;width:100%;top:0;left:0;z-index:10;mix-blend-mode:exclusion}.Header_Header__wrap__1km51{padding:28px 5%}.Header_Header__head__Epy1F{width:clamp(80px,14.3229166667vw,110px)}.Header_Header__head__Epy1F a{display:block}.Header_Header__head__Epy1F a svg{aspect-ratio:51.78/21.54;width:100%;height:auto;fill:#bab398}.FooterNav_FooterNav__9YRx4{display:grid;grid-column:2/4;grid-template-columns:repeat(2,1fr);gap:0 max(2cqw,20px)}@media screen and (max-width:768px){.FooterNav_FooterNav__9YRx4{grid-template-columns:1fr;width:100%;margin-bottom:24px}}.FooterNav_FooterNav__items__54SGE{display:flex;flex-direction:column;height:100%}@media screen and (max-width:768px){.FooterNav_FooterNav__items__54SGE:not(:last-child) li:nth-last-child(2){margin-top:0}}.FooterNav_FooterNav__item__Gt1_2 a{white-space:nowrap;font-size:14px}@media screen and (max-width:768px){.FooterNav_FooterNav__item__Gt1_2 a{display:block;line-height:2}}.FooterNav_FooterNav__item__Gt1_2:nth-last-child(2){margin-top:1.5em}@media screen and (max-width:768px){.FooterNav_FooterNav__item__Gt1_2:nth-last-child(2){margin-top:.5em}}.Footer_Footer__z0Ikr{padding:60px 0 40px;border-top:1px solid #454c67}.Footer_Footer__wrap___cyN1{display:grid;grid-template-columns:repeat(4,1fr);gap:0 max(2cqw,20px)}@media screen and (max-width:768px){.Footer_Footer__wrap___cyN1{display:flex;flex-wrap:wrap;gap:12px}}.Footer_Footer__item__qfZWP{display:flex;flex-direction:column;align-items:flex-start;gap:6px;font-size:12px}.Footer_Footer__head__2Znjb{display:block;width:90px}.Footer_Footer__head__2Znjb svg{width:100%;height:auto;fill:#454c67}.Footer_Footer__tel__0a2_d{display:flex;flex-direction:column;gap:4px}.Footer_Footer__tel__0a2_d small{font-size:10px}.Footer_Footer__copy__ovb1b{display:inline-block;margin:auto 0 0 auto;font-size:12px;letter-spacing:.05em}@media screen and (max-width:768px){.Footer_Footer__copy__ovb1b{width:100%;text-align:right}}.Cta_Cta__tcLIF{position:relative;font-weight:500;color:#f9f9f9;overflow:hidden}.Cta_Cta__tcLIF a{display:flex;flex-direction:column;align-items:flex-start;padding:85px 0 105px;background:#2c2c2c;transition:background .6s}@media screen and (max-width:768px){.Cta_Cta__tcLIF a{padding:clamp(65px,17.3333333333vw,75px) 0 clamp(75px,20vw,85px)}}@media(any-hover:hover){.Cta_Cta__tcLIF a:hover{opacity:1;background:#454c67}.Cta_Cta__tcLIF a:hover em,.Cta_Cta__tcLIF a:hover i,.Cta_Cta__tcLIF a:hover span{scale:1 300;filter:blur(2px);animation:Cta_horizontalMove__bcV2M 4.5s linear infinite}}.Cta_Cta__tcLIF div{position:relative}.Cta_Cta__tcLIF em{display:block;font-size:clamp(32px,8.5333333333vw,40px);line-height:1.8823529412}.Cta_Cta__tcLIF span{display:block;font-size:clamp(12px,3.2vw,14px);font-size:12px;line-height:2.5}.Cta_Cta__tcLIF i{position:absolute;aspect-ratio:1;display:flex;justify-content:center;align-items:center;width:90px;bottom:5px;right:0;border:1px solid #f9f9f9;border-radius:50%;fill:#f9f9f9}@media screen and (max-width:768px){.Cta_Cta__tcLIF i{width:80px;bottom:-60px}}@keyframes Cta_horizontalMove__bcV2M{0%{transform:translateY(50%)}to{transform:translateY(-50%)}}.Nav_NavBtn__m_j8U{position:fixed;display:flex;justify-content:center;align-items:center;gap:.25em;top:30px;right:5%;font-size:clamp(18px,4.8vw,22px);line-height:1.5555555556;font-weight:700;color:#bab398;font-family:transat-text,YuGothic,dnp-shuei-gothic-gin-std,Yu Gothic,Hiragino Sans,Hiragino Kaku Gothic ProN,Meiryo,Osaka,sans-serif;text-transform:lowercase;letter-spacing:.1em;z-index:1000;mix-blend-mode:exclusion}.Nav_NavBtn__m_j8U i{position:relative;width:clamp(22px,5.8666666667vw,26px);height:2px;border-radius:2px;transform:translateY(2px);background:#bab398;transition:background .3s,transform .3s}.Nav_NavBtn__m_j8U i:after,.Nav_NavBtn__m_j8U i:before{content:"";position:absolute;width:100%;height:2px;left:0;border-radius:2px;background:#bab398;transition:top .3s,transform .3s}.Nav_NavBtn__m_j8U i:before{top:-4px}.Nav_NavBtn__m_j8U i:after{top:4px}.Nav_NavBtn__m_j8U[aria-expanded=true] i{transform:none;background:none}.Nav_NavBtn__m_j8U[aria-expanded=true] i:before{top:0;transform:rotate(45deg)}.Nav_NavBtn__m_j8U[aria-expanded=true] i:after{top:0;transform:rotate(-45deg)}.Nav_Nav__BUgyu{pointer-events:none;position:fixed;top:38px;right:5%;z-index:100;mix-blend-mode:exclusion;transition:opacity .3s,visibility .3s;opacity:0;visibility:visible}@media screen and (max-width:768px){.Nav_Nav__BUgyu{width:100%;height:100%;top:0;right:0;background:#f9f9f9;mix-blend-mode:inherit}}.Nav_Nav__BUgyu[aria-hidden=false]{pointer-events:auto;opacity:1;visibility:visible}.Nav_Nav__BUgyu[aria-hidden=false] li{transform:translateY(34px)}@media screen and (max-width:768px){.Nav_Nav__wrap__6nhs0{height:100%;padding:34px 5%;overflow-y:auto}.Nav_Nav__item__U5NVT{position:relative}}.Nav_Nav__links__qI_qr{display:grid;grid-template-columns:repeat(2,auto);grid-template-rows:repeat(3,auto);grid-auto-flow:column;-moz-column-gap:2.5em;column-gap:2.5em}@media screen and (max-width:768px){.Nav_Nav__links__qI_qr{grid-template-columns:1fr;grid-template-rows:auto;grid-auto-flow:inherit;-moz-column-gap:1.5em;column-gap:1.5em}}.Nav_Nav__link__d_cjZ{display:flex;justify-content:flex-end;transform:translateY(0);transition:transform .5s}.Nav_Nav__link__d_cjZ a{display:flex;flex-direction:column;align-items:flex-end;padding:2px 0;white-space:nowrap;font-size:clamp(16px,4.2666666667vw,18px);line-height:1.5555555556;color:#bab398;font-family:transat-text,YuGothic,dnp-shuei-gothic-gin-std,Yu Gothic,Hiragino Sans,Hiragino Kaku Gothic ProN,Meiryo,Osaka,sans-serif;text-indent:.075em}@media screen and (max-width:768px){.Nav_Nav__link__d_cjZ a{color:#484e68}}.Nav_Nav__link__d_cjZ a:after{content:"";width:100%;height:2px;background:#bab398;transition:transform .4s;transform:scaleX(0);transform-origin:left}@media(any-hover:hover){.Nav_Nav__link__d_cjZ a:hover:after{transform:scaleX(1)}}.Nav_Nav__link__d_cjZ:nth-child(2),.Nav_Nav__link__d_cjZ:nth-child(5){transform:translateY(-34px)}.Nav_Nav__link__d_cjZ:nth-child(3),.Nav_Nav__link__d_cjZ:nth-child(6){transform:translateY(-68px)}@media screen and (max-width:768px){.Nav_Nav__link__d_cjZ:nth-child(4){transform:translateY(-102px)}.Nav_Nav__link__d_cjZ:nth-child(5){transform:translateY(-136px)}.Nav_Nav__link__d_cjZ:nth-child(6){transform:translateY(-170px)}}.Nav_Nav__logo__wny0p{display:none}@media screen and (max-width:768px){.Nav_Nav__logo__wny0p{position:absolute;display:block;width:48vw;max-width:278px;bottom:5px;left:50%;transform:translateX(-50%);fill:#dadada}}.Nav_Nav__logo__wny0p svg{width:100%}